Tarah
Tarah is a camping place along Israel's wilderness itinerary in Numbers 33. The UPDV renders the place name "Terah."
A Camping Place of the Israelites
The wilderness register names two consecutive stages: "And they journeyed from Tahath, and encamped in Terah. And they journeyed from Terah, and encamped in Mithkah" (Nu 33:27-28). The site appears only as a way-station — Israel arrives, then departs — within the longer chain of encampments listed for the journey.
